[quote=Anonymous][quote=Anonymous]You might look and see what the local CC's have on offer. Maybe just perusing the program list will spark some interest. Talk to your neighbor, for sure. Think about what he likes to do, his hobbies, his preference for inside/outside, computer/hands, interacting with others/working alone, etc. And have him consider some basic business classes at a CC, which are useful for lots of different vocations -- running his own business or working for a small business.[/quote] I was going to make this same suggestion about programs offered at community colleges - lots have certificate programs to start in a career with advancement opportunities after a year or two of training. Another idea is ultrasound technician. [/quote]
